Joel de Jesus grew up in Point Hope, Alaska, a whaling community 200 miles north of the Arctic Circle.  His family moved away when he was in the sixth grade, and he never went back—until now, 15 years later, he decided to return to document Qagruq, Point Hope's annual whaling feast.

This film premiered at the Anchorage Museum on August 5, 2016.
